Why don't we have laws that keep automatic weapons out of the hands of those who threaten us in our daily lives?

Here we have another example of the blatant dishonesty of anti-gun zealots.

Automatic weapons have been strictly regulated (virtually impossible for the average civilian to obtain and/or afford) since the National Firearms Act of 1934.

In all my decades of visiting gun stores, gun shows, etc., I have never even SEEN an automatic weapon, much less seen one for sale.

I'm sure the founding fathers, who gave us the Second Amendment, could not have imagined grenade launchers and shoulder-held rocket launchers.

"Should-held rocket launcher"!? More dishonesty and hyperbole.

BTW Our Founding Fathers could not have imagined TV, radio or the internet, either. Using this demented individuals logic, the First Amendment should apply only to the hand-operated printing press, the quill pen, and the spoken word.

These citizens want to keep guns out of the hands of people with a history of mental illness or spousal abuse or felony convictions.

More blatant dishonesty.

Anyone having been adjudicated mentally ill cannot legally purchase, own or possess a firearm.

Thanks primarily to Sen. Frank Lautenberg, anyone guilty of misdemeanor domestic violence may not legally purchase, own or possess a firearm.

A felon may not legally purchase, own or possess a firearm.

All of this is very clearly stated on ATF form 4473.
